Fred, I hate to disagree with you, but I can find no such references in my
Hagerty policy.  I insure my TR3A for $86.00 a year with no mileage
limitation and no restrictions on use.  The only restriction is that I must
own another vehicle, insured separately, as my primary means of
transportation.  The ploicy is actually written with CNA, through the
Hagerty agency.

>> I just got my '70 TR6 insured in California from Hagerty's, and found
>> their rates and coverage to be excellent.  Their policy has no formal
>> mileage limit and use limits are as liberal as any I've seen (as the
>> phone operator put it "as long as you're not towing with it or doing
>> something illegal with it, we aren't worried about use").  The policy is
>> agreed value and must be in addition to a "regular" car with insurance
>> with a traditional carrier.  My TR6, in fair to good condition, that I
>> valued at $5000, costs me $62/year premium, agreed value, zero
>> deductable coverage in Los Angeles.  Can't be beat, IMO.
